...Ferguson family of Belmond, Iowa, are more than merely an Iowa farming family, they are truly typical of middle-class American and in tracing the changing texture of their life Miss Suckow portrays the loss of faith and security which has followed the war. Their four children seem to be typical middle-western youngsters but the outside change and movement is reflected upon them and they drift rapidly away from their parents. Carl, the eldest and the pet of the family and the town, drifts through force of habit into marriage with a childhood sweetheart and after a few years...
...simple in plan, The Folks is the story of an Iowa family, from the early years of the century to the present. As the story opens, Fred Ferguson, officer in a small-town bank, and his wife Annie are approaching middle age. They have three children and one to come. The old folks still live on the farm outside the town...
